Bitcoin (BTC) Christmas Price History 2010–2025: $87,600 in 2025, -10.6% YoY, ~134% CAGR Data for Traders
According to @BullTheoryio, BTC closed Christmas Day 2025 at $87,600, a 10.6% year-over-year decline from $98,000 on Christmas 2024 (source: @BullTheoryio). According to @BullTheoryio, the data show BTC rising from $0.25 on Christmas 2010 to $87,600 in 2025, implying an approximately 134% 15-year CAGR based on those figures (source: @BullTheoryio). According to @BullTheoryio, historical Christmas-to-Christmas drawdowns included 2014 (-53%), 2018 (-73%), and 2022 (-67%), underscoring high downside volatility relevant for risk sizing and stop placement (source: @BullTheoryio). According to @BullTheoryio, major upside Christmas prints included 2013 (+5,146%), 2017 (+1,463%), 2020 (+242%), 2021 (+105%), 2023 (+160%), and 2024 (+125%), highlighting boom-bust cycles that can favor trend-following strategies during momentum regimes (source: @BullTheoryio). Bitcoin (BTC) Whitepaper Turns 17: October Seasonality and Post-Halving Q4 Signals Traders Are Watching in 2025
According to the source, the segment highlights Bitcoin’s 17th whitepaper anniversary and questions whether October could close red for BTC, a setup traders are watching into the monthly close. source: x.com/i/broadcasts/1rmxPvbXymYGN Bitcoin’s whitepaper was released on 2008-10-31 by Satoshi Nakamoto, making Oct 31, 2025 the 17-year milestone for the network. source: bitcoin.org/bitcoin.pdf and metzdowd.com/pipermail/cryptography/2008-October/014810.html The anniversary lands in the first Q4 after the April 2024 halving that reduced the block subsidy to 3.125 BTC at block 840000, tightening new supply. source: bitcoinblockhalf.com Historical monthly return dashboards show October has often been positive for BTC in past cycles, though exceptions exist, so traders typically monitor the monthly close for confirmation. source: coinglass.com |
